Staging Your House for Sale

Big Bear HouseBig Bear Real Estate offers a diverse selection of houses and properties for sale and so it is important to create a good first impression for potential buyers. At the moment, the inventory levels for Big Bear are high and this means there is more competition for those selling. This buyer’s market gives home shoppers many options to choose from and so they tend to become more selective.

As a result, Big Bear house buyers are likely to be less forgiving when it comes to any issues or flaws. Those problems can hinder a sale because with so many choices on the market, there is little desire from the buyer to invest additional time, money, or effort in fixing the property.

So, if you are wanting to sell your home, focus on making an impact. The goal should be to get the property as attractive as possible so that when potential home buyers come by, they get a favorable first impression. If the exterior of the home and yard look presentable, this “curb appeal” is likely to result in a home tour.

Now although you can work on such tasks after your home is listed, keep in mind that investing in repairs prior to putting your home up for sale is the best strategy since negotiating with a buyer after a home inspection is usually more costly.

Big Bear Property Exterior Staging Tips

  • Driveway
    • remove weeds & pine needles & pine cones
    • sweep
    • fix cracks & renew sealing
  • Yard
    • remove all debris
    • trim branches, tree limbs, dead vegetation
    • rake up leaves, pine needles & pine cones
  • Landscape
    • weed and trim bushes away from the home exterior
    • mulch flower beds
    • cover beds with decorative bark
    • plant native foliage
    • ask gardening or landscape professionals for fall & winter presentation ideas
  • Decks
    • clean
    • repair
    • stain
    • seal
  • Roof & Gutters
    • remove pine needles
    • clean & repair
  • Trim & Sidings
    • clear away cobwebs
    • wash down surfaces
    • replace any damaged boards
    • touch up with putty & paint
  • Windows
    • professionally service interior & exterior panes
  • Entry
    • clear entry
    • sweep & clean
    • use color
    • add inviting decor
    • touch up paint
    • install new welcome mat

Big Bear House Interior Staging Tips

  • Let in Light
    • enhance natural light
    •  strategically place interior lamps
  • Touch Up
    • clean & paint walls & ceiling
    • repair & spot paint trim
  • Declutter
    • remove personal belongings
    • store non-essential furniture
  • Deep Clean
    • professionally service floor surfaces, lighting, fans & walls.
  • Kitchen
    • clear
    • clean
    • re-caulk or re-grout
    • repair & clean faucets
    • clean under, inside & outside appliances
  • Bathroom
    • clear
    • clean
    • re-caulk
    • repair & clean faucets
    • fix any molded or mildewed areas
    • repair leaky faucets
    • replace any dingy looking hardware
  • Other Rooms
    • clear closets & storage areas
    • neatly organize storage spaces
  • Garage & Sheds
    • clean
    • organize
